Convert Terahenry to Esu Of Inductance

Conversion Formula for Terahenry to Esu Of Inductance

The formula of conversion of Terahenry to Esu Of Inductance is very simple. To convert Terahenry to Esu Of Inductance, we can use this simple formula:

1 Terahenry = 1.1126500557 Esu Of Inductance

1 Esu Of Inductance = 0.898755179 Terahenry

One Terahenry is equal to 1.1126500557 Esu Of Inductance. So, we need to multiply the number of Terahenry by 1.1126500557 to get the no of Esu Of Inductance. This formula helps when we need to change the measurements from Terahenry to Esu Of Inductance

Details for Terahenry (10¹² Henries)

Introduction : A terahenry equals one trillion henries (10¹² H). It is an abstract unit used in calculations involving extremely high inductance values, mostly in theoretical modeling or computational scenarios. This unit is not encountered in practical inductors or power systems due to its enormity.

History & Origin : The terahenry was introduced along with other SI multiples for theoretical consistency in electromagnetics and high-level physical modeling. Its inclusion allows scientists to express vast quantities without breaking the standard SI framework.

Current Use : Used in large-scale simulations or hypothetical scenarios such as magnetic fields in planetary or cosmic systems. It supports abstract modeling but remains non-physical for most electrical devices and components.

Details for Electrostatic Unit of Inductance (Same as Stathenry)

Introduction : The ESU of inductance, also called the stathenry, is a legacy unit from the electrostatic CGS system. It has no modern engineering use but plays a role in historical and theoretical discussions.

History & Origin : Part of the CGS ESU framework, this unit arose when separate systems existed for electric and magnetic phenomena. It was eventually replaced by SI standards due to the need for unified units.

Current Use : Used primarily in academic contexts, particularly in the study of classical electromagnetism and the evolution of measurement systems. It has no place in modern component specifications.
